链路负载均衡的原理
负载均衡器的作用链路负载均衡是一种网络管理技术,用于在多个服务器之间分配网络流量,以实现高可用性和高性能的网络服务。它通过将网络流量均匀分布到不同的服务器上,避免某一台服务器过载,从而提高整体系统的性能和可靠性。
链路负载均衡的原理基于以下几个关键要素:
1. 负载均衡器:负载均衡器是整个系统的核心。它作为一个中间层,接收来自客户端的请求,并根据一定的算法将请求分发到后端的服务器上。
2. 健康检查:负载均衡器通过定期向后端服务器发送健康检查请求来监测它们的状态。如果某个服务器宕机或出现故障,负载均衡器将自动从服务器池中移除该服务器,确保该服务器不再接收新的请求,从而提高系统的可用性。
3. 负载均衡算法:负载均衡器使用不同的算法来决定将请求发送到哪个后端服务器上。常见的算法包括轮询、最少连接和哈希等。轮询算法按照顺序将请求分发到每个服务器,最少连接算法选择连接数最少的服务器,而哈希算法根据请求的某个特定属性(例如源IP地址)进行分发。
4. 会话保持:有些应用程序需要保持用户会话的状态,即使请求被分发到不同的服务器上。为了实现这一点,负载均衡器可以通过使用cookies或将会话信息存储在共享存储中来识别特定用户,并将其请求发送到处理该用户会话的同一台服务器上。
总的来说,链路负载均衡的原理是通过负载均衡器将流量均匀分配到多台后端服务器上,避免单点故障和过载,提高系统的可靠性和性能。它的应用范围很广,包括网站、应用程序、数据库和云服务等。通过合理配置和使用负载均衡技术,可以实现更好的用户体验和高效的系统运行。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论